President calls to protect the country shedding political motives
President Mahinda Rajapakse has called upon all sections of people to forget about political motives and work thoughtfully towards the development of the country. He expressed this during his address at the pioneer seminar for the personnel of the cooperative sector.
Sri Lanka is the motherland of three communities. It is our duty to prevent the division of our motherland. The present war is not a one against one community, but a campaign to eradicate terrorism.
Terrorists are terrorists irrespective of the country they operate. Certain sections in our country try to give a different interpretation and want to gain narrow political mileage. We have to establish a conducive environment for all the communities to live fearlessly and peacefully. There are people who are deprived of facilities to make even registration of marriages and complaints at police stations in the Tamil language. There are language-training courses being conducted to rectify this situation. 3200 Tamil medium teachers to the estate sector were recruited, said the President.
